Desert Ballads
by Doug Lowell
Photographs: Doug Lowell
Publisher: loveheadhouse
Year: 2023
ISBN: 979-8-9858517-2-4
Price: 45 €
Comments: softcover
Desert Ballads is a response, of sorts, to Federico Garcia Lorca’s book of poems, Gypsy Ballads, in which the poet climbs the slope between narrative and its disintegration into lyric. About one of the ballads Lorca’s friend Salvadore Dali famously said, “You think there’s a story there, but there isn’t.” The four ballads in this book were photographed in and around Maupin, Oregon, which is my own version of Lorca’s beloved Andalucia.
